The MSP430F2122TRHB is a 16-bit ultra-low-power microcontroller from Texas Instruments, designed for applications requiring efficient power management. It operates within a supply voltage range of 1.8 V to 3.6 V and features a 4 kB Flash memory and 512 B RAM. The device includes a 10-bit analog-to-digital converter (ADC) capable of 200 ksps, along with a universal serial communication interface (USCI) that supports various communication protocols including UART, SPI, and I¬=C. This microcontroller is optimized for low power consumption, with an active mode current of 250 ¬µA at 1 MHz and 2.2 V, and a standby mode current of just 0.7 ¬µA. It also supports ultra-fast wake-up from standby in less than 1 ¬µs. The MSP430F2122TRHB is equipped with two 16-bit timers and an on-chip comparator for analog signal processing. It is available in a 32-pin QFN package and is suitable for a wide range of portable measurement applications, particularly where battery life is critical.
